Thanks for reviewing. The patch came from Aaron finding an odd opcode
in traces of SPEC which objdump disassembled as stswxl, then Aaron
saying he couldn't find that in ISA 3.0 or 2.07.
Of course, even after this patch objdump still disassembles the opcode
to stswxl since we default to power9 with PPC_OPCODE_ANY, if objdump
is invoked without selected a cpu.
On another subject, I'd like your opinion on removing -[mM]htm options
from gas and the disassembler. I think now that it was a mistake to
add them in the first place (and every other use of .sticky except for
-mall and -mraw). I would have liked to remove -[mM]vsx too, but
"gcc -mvsx" passes on -mvsx to gas, and has done so for quite some
time. So -mvsx looks impossible to remove without breaking gcc.
"gcc -mhtm" on the other hand, passes -mpower8 to gas, and it's been
that way since -mhtm was added to gcc.
Also, I'm intending to remove some of PPC_OPCODE_*, for instance
PPC_OPCODE_ALTIVEC2 can disappear and we then use
#define PPCVEC2 (PPC_OPCODE_POWER8 | PPC_OPCODE_E6500)
#define PPCVEC3 PPC_OPCODE_POWER9
in opcodes/ppc-opc.c which should improve gas opcode checks vs. cpu.
Dodgy gcc output would then be found at compile time rather than run
time (assuming -many is removed from powerpc gcc, another little
project of mine).

I was going to say you cannot remove it, because we use gcc's -mhtm
option to build LIBITM, but if we're passing -mpower8 to the assembler
when using gcc's -mhtm option, then I guess it's ok if there are no
users outside of binutils that use the -mhtm gas option (kernel?).
I'm sure I was going to have gcc pass -mhtm to gas instead of -mpower8,
but since I didn't , I guess this is ok.
I agree, we're stuck keeping -mvsx.
> Also, I'm intending to remove some of PPC_OPCODE_*, for instance
> PPC_OPCODE_ALTIVEC2 can disappear and we then use
>
> #define PPCVEC2 (PPC_OPCODE_POWER8 | PPC_OPCODE_E6500)
> #define PPCVEC3 PPC_OPCODE_POWER9
>
> in opcodes/ppc-opc.c which should improve gas opcode checks vs. cpu.
> Dodgy gcc output would then be found at compile time rather than run
> time
Looking at how PPCVEC2 and PPCVEC3 are used, yeah, that should work.
I also like that we can reclaim some bits in the cpu mask, since
there are only a limited amount of them.
Can we also get rid of PPC_OPCODE_HTM and use...?
#define PPCHTM PPC_OPCODE_POWER8
> (assuming -many is removed from powerpc gcc, another little
> project of mine).
I never liked gcc always passing -many to the assembler, so if
you can remove it, I'm all for it!
